Cysticercosis is a health problem in Reunion Island. A representative sample (3388 sera) of the Reunion population (more than 14 years of age) shows a prevalence of 8.2%. A statistically significant correlation is found with mode of transmission (pig raising, toilet). This result contributes to proposed measures of prevention.Entities:
